plato típico
  25

The typical dish is the dish that like most and most consumed in a city, region or country; It is also the dish that represents the particular tastes of the majority of the people inhabiting the place. For example, the typical dish of Spain is paella; of Buenos Aires ( Argentina ) is roast lamb; of Sincelejo ( Colombia ) is the mote of cheese; the other regions of Colombia and Barranquilla is the churrasco.
